We are passionate about involving the local community in our lunch programs. All ingredients for uji porridge are purchased from local farmers to encourage sustainability. The children bring firewood from their homes and carry buckets of clean water from the local well to school. Jobs are created as parents are hired to cook the porridge over the open fire, serving the meal to the children in cups
